summ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Daniel Stenberg <daniel@haxx.se>2021-11-08 14:48:11 +0100
committerDaniel Stenberg <daniel@haxx.se>2021-11-08 16:13:42 +0100
commit5c1e1d9aa46302b0f9999f088ba87e10a9779254 (patch)
treeb5d91da6e1d5027d4f45f4238b2230309b6fd45b
parent9e9fef9e244e99dcf877ddbece461eaa8d609e2c (diff)
downloadcurl-5c1e1d9aa46302b0f9999f088ba87e10a9779254.tar.gz
curl_easy_perform.3: add a para about recv and send data
Reported-by: Godwin Stewart Fixes #7973 Closes #7974
-rw-r--r--docs/libcurl/curl_easy_perform.36
1 files changed, 6 insertions, 0 deletions
diff --git a/docs/libcurl/curl_easy_perform.3 b/docs/libcurl/curl_easy_perform.3
index 01c543f4a..1267fb8fd 100644
--- a/docs/libcurl/curl_easy_perform.3
+++ b/docs/libcurl/curl_easy_perform.3
@@ -50,6 +50,12 @@ same \fBeasy_handle\fP. Let the function return first before invoking it
another time. If you want parallel transfers, you must use several curl
easy_handles.
+A network transfer moves data to a peer or from a peer. An application tells
+libcurl how to receive data by setting the \fICURLOPT_WRITEFUNCTION(3)\fP and
+\fICURLOPT_WRITEDATA(3)\fP options. To tell libcurl what data to send, there
+are a few more alternatives but two common ones are
+\fICURLOPT_READFUNCTION(3)\fP and \fICURLOPT_POSTFIELDS(3)\fP.
+
While the \fBeasy_handle\fP is added to a multi handle, it cannot be used by
\fIcurl_easy_perform(3)\fP.
.SH EXAMPLE